Chapter 7 | Prayer before the fall of Misfortune
3ـ عِدَّةٌ مِنْ أَصْحَابِنَا عَنْ أَحْمَدَ بْنِ مُحَمَّدِ بْنِ خَالِدٍ عَنْ إِسْمَاعِيلَ بْنِ مِهْرَانَ عَنْ مَنْصُورِ بْنِ يُونُسَ عَنْ هَارُونَ بْنِ خَارِجَةَ عَنْ أَبِي عَبْدِ الله (عَلَيهِ السَّلام) قَالَ إِنَّ الدُّعَاءَ فِي الرَّخَاءِ يَسْتَخْرِجُ الْحَوَائِجَ فِي الْبَلاءِ.
3. A number of our people have narrated from Ahmad ibn Muhammad ibn Khalid from Isma’Il ibn Mehran from Mansur ibn Yunus from Harun ibn Kharijah from Abu ‘Abdillah who has said the following: “Abu ‘Abd Allah has said, ‘Prayer and pleading before Allah for help in one’s enjoying well-being brings about (causes to happen) what one needs in the fall of misfortune.’”
